The Origins and Evolution of Financial Backing
The contemporary equity capital sector created significantly after the Second World War, especially in the USA. Very early investors acknowledged that many technological advancements needed considerable financial backing prior to coming to be readily successful. One of the earliest examples of arranged equity capital was the establishment of American Research and Development Corporation (ARDC) in 1946, which bought technology-focused companies.
Over time, venture capital increased past modern technology and came to be a significant source of financing for markets such as medical care, biotechnology, renewable energy, artificial intelligence, and customer services. The surge of Silicon Valley demonstrated the transformative possibility of equity capital, as investment company assisted money companies that later on became international leaders, including significant technology corporations.
Today, financial backing runs worldwide, with financial investment centers developing in regions such as The United States and Canada, Europe, Asia, and emerging markets. The sector continues to advance as capitalists look for opportunities in new modern technologies and innovative service versions.
The Role of Financial Backing in Entrepreneurship
Beginning a company commonly calls for more than a good concept. Entrepreneurs need funds, market knowledge, specialist networks, and critical support. Venture capital firms supply these resources by buying firms that show strong development possibility.
Unlike typical bank loans, venture capital financial investments do not need instant settlement. Rather, financiers accept the possibility of shedding their financial investment in exchange for the possibility to accomplish significant returns. This method allows entrepreneurs to focus on creating products, increasing markets, and constructing their firms without the pressure of temporary financial obligation obligations.
Along with funding, venture capitalists commonly offer mentorship and support. Lots of financiers have considerable experience in organization development, advertising, operations, and monitoring. Their advice can help entrepreneurs prevent typical blunders and make informed choices throughout critical points of development.
In addition, venture capital networks attach startups with prospective companions, clients, workers, and future investors. These relationships can substantially enhance a company’s possibilities of success and accelerate its development.

Challenges and Criticism of Venture Capital
Regardless of its favorable effect, venture capital is not without difficulties. The market entails significant risks due to the fact that several start-ups fall short to achieve commercial success. Capitalists have to meticulously examine company designs, market problems, leadership groups, and competitive advantages before devoting funds.
One more objection is that financial backing can urge firms to focus on quick growth over long-lasting sustainability. Startups backed by financiers may deal with pressure to accomplish high assessments and broaden promptly, in some cases causing excessive investing or unrealistic expectations.
In addition, access to financial backing is not equally dispersed. Particular areas, sectors, and market teams have actually historically gotten even more financial investment possibilities than others. This has actually increased concerns regarding diversity and incorporation within entrepreneurship ecological communities. Increasing accessibility to funding for underrepresented creators stays an important obstacle for the venture capital market.
